Compared to cities within the industrialized countries, cities of comparable sizes in resource-rich and deindustrializing economies have lower shares of employment in manufacturing, tradable providers, and the formal sector, and better shares of employment in non-tradables and the informal sector. In the industrialized international locations, the employment share of tradables is high while that of non-tradables is low across cities of all sizes. In both resource-rich and deindustrializing international locations, larger cities have substantially larger shares of non-tradables than smaller cities, however for all metropolis sizes these shares are a lot bigger within the deindustrializing than resource-rich international locations.

The long-term prospects for food security will be undermined further by low agricultural productivity development, particularly in Africa and South Asia, according to GHI’s evaluation within the 2017 GAP Report. According to the GAP Report, world agricultural productiveness should enhance by 1.75% yearly to satisfy the calls for of nearly 10 billion folks in 2050. GHI’s annual evaluation of worldwide productivity growth – the GAP Index – shows the present fee of progress is just one.66%. That’s fairly impressive—it means that we're growing agricultural productivity sooner than we're increasing the inputs needed to supply that output. This is especially true in high-income regions, where the vast majority of output growth could be attributed to will increase in effectivity.

Specifically, a uniform increase within the productiveness of all of the inputs employed within the production process, or TFP progress, reduces the costs of production, which in turn allows the producers that benefit from the innovation to cost a cheaper price in comparability with their rivals. By charging a cheaper price, the innovating country can capture a bigger market share in the vacation spot market, thus displacing different producers. The displaced producers, in flip, are forced to reduce their ranges of provide, reducing the pressures to broaden on cropland. There are theories about why agricultural productiveness progress has been faring poorly within the creating countries that appear as if they want to have essentially the most room for positive aspects. Perhaps the agricultural sector in those countries is much less versatile and aware of shifts in patterns of climate or crop illness. Some of the agricultural productiveness gains in higher-income countries are based mostly on customizing production using info and feedback from satellite tv for pc, internet, and mobile infrastructure, which is less obtainable in growing economies.

The Chinese authorities has prioritized the consolidation of agricultural land, creating alternatives for higher efficiency, particularly in the wheat-growing regions. Mechanization services and fertilizer use effectivity have additionally improved, generating productivity gains. The TFP data do not but replicate the impact of the African swine fever outbreak that has killed 40% of China’s swine inhabitants, however it will likely be significant.
